Another full day in Kawale


We arrived early at the Orphan Care Centre then immediately headed out into the community for home based care visits to the sick. We offered encouragement, prayer, song and scripture. The passage we used today was Prov 3:24 “When you lie down you will not be afraid...”

Back at the centre the children enjoyed listening to the flannel graph story of Baby Moses and the bullrushes. We were taken back with the question asked by one of the children when he said “did the mother ever come back?” It shows us their fear of losing a parent.

The leadership training session with the widows and chiefs centered around the story of Elisha and the widow and the jar of oil which brought home the point of God's provision for His people. The chiefs were very appreciative and felt that the message was appropriate for them at this point in time.

On a lighter side, the children had a great time playing with the soccer balls, and playing “Duck Duck Goose”. The girls (and boys!) loved it when we painted their finger nails in bright colors.

Later on in the day we visited the vocational school in Area 44 to see the work in progress with plastering and painting for which Lydia had fundraised to celebrate her 60th birthday. The school has classrooms to accommodate pre-school to grade 4. Earlier Alice met with the teachers to discuss various teaching methods and new ideas to enhance their program. There will be more in depth training tomorrow for the teachers.
